Start off in Jerusalem
Matthew 10:5 These twelve Jesus sent out and commanded them, saying: “Do not go into the way of the Gentiles, and do not enter a city of the Samaritans.
6 But go rather to the lost sheep of the house of Israel.
Jesus sends out the 12 with orders. Your mission is to go throughout Israel. Proclaiming the kingdom of God is at hand. The Lord would later reach out to Samaria and the outer regions of the gentiles, but now was the time for Israel to recognize their messiah. The holy scriptures came thru the Jewish nation. The "do nots" are as important as the do's." Besides, I dont think these 12 were ready theologically for the gentiles. Reach out first to those close to you, whom you know. Who know you. The early church learned this as they first started in Jerusalem, Judea, then Samaria, then the ends of the earth.
